Awareness program on New Criminal Laws Held at GDC Frisal

Kulgam, June 27, 2025: A special awareness session on the three newly enacted criminal laws was held today at Government Degree College (GDC) Frisal. The session aimed at educating students and staff about the key changes and implications of the new legal framework.

The event featured Javid Iqbal, Tehsildar Frisal, as the Resource Person, who delivered an insightful lecture on the salient features of the new laws —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, and Bharatiya Sakshya Adhiniyam, which replace the IPC, CrPC, and Evidence Act respectively. He emphasized the progressive reforms and citizen-centric provisions embedded in the updated legal codes.

Another Resource person Professor Shokit Ahmed Malik, In-charge Principal of GDC Frisal, presided over the event. In his address, he appreciated the initiative and stressed the importance of legal literacy among the youth in a democratic society.

The program concluded with an interactive Q&A session, where students engaged actively with the resource person, gaining deeper insights into the implications of the new criminal justice system.
